Google Adds Study Tools to Search and Gemini for Back-to-School Season

·3 min read·TechCrunch

Google has integrated new study features directly into Search and its Gemini AI assistant, targeting students preparing for the school year. The tools include research organization, flashcard creation, practice quizzes, and study notebooks—all accessible within Google's existing products. This move reflects Google's broader push to position Gemini as the go-to AI tool for educational use cases, competing directly with OpenAI's offerings in the student market.
